Purification and properties of a stilbene synthase from induced cell suspension cultures of peanut.
Schoppner A., Kindl H.
Stilbene synthase ( resveratrol -forming) converts one molecule of rho-coumaroyl -CoA and three molecules of malonyl-CoA into 3,4',5-trihydroxystilbene . Following selective induction of stilbene synthesis in cell suspension cultures of peanut (Arachis hypogaea), the enzyme was extracted and purified to apparent homogeneity by chromatography on DEAE-cellulose and hydroxylapatite. The enzyme was found to be a dimer of estimated Mr = 90,000 exhibiting under denaturing conditions a subunit Mr of approximately 45,000. The isoelectric point was determined with pI = 4.8. The enzyme's high selectivity towards rho-coumaroyl -CoA (Km = 2 microM) as substrate qualified it as resveratrol -forming stilbene synthase. Structurally related CoA esters, e.g. dihydro-rho-coumaroyl -CoA and cinnamoyl-CoA, were converted less than 1/10 as efficiently as rho-coumaroyl -CoA. Malonyl-CoA (Km = 10 microM) could not be substituted by acetyl-CoA. The purified enzyme was free of chalcone synthase activity. Antibodies raised against stilbene synthase were shown to be monospecific and not to cross-react with chalcone synthase. << Less
